Where to Use With Caution
While the Sunflower Pumpkin - Watercolor Borders is generally easy to work with, there are a few areas where care is needed. On small hoop sizes, the design may require splitting or adjusting to fit properly. Textured fabrics or thin materials can also affect how the stitches lay, potentially causing the design to appear less crisp.
On dark fabrics, the contrast between the design and background may be less striking, depending on the thread colors chosen. Similarly, stretchy or curved surfaces like caps can challenge the precision of the stitching, especially in detailed corners or around the pumpkin’s edges. For these reasons, testing the design on scrap fabric before committing to a final project is always a good idea.

Practical Designer Notes
Before using the Sunflower Pumpkin - Watercolor Borders in your next project, take the time to test it on different fabrics and thread colors. Check the stitch density to ensure it won’t cause puckering or distortion, especially on delicate materials. Confirm the hoop size required for your machine and consider whether the design will need additional stabilizer support.
Inspecting small details, such as the edges of the pumpkin or the flow of the borders, is essential. These elements can be easily overlooked but have a big impact on the final appearance. Testing the design in black and white mockups can also help you see how it will look on various fabric backgrounds, ensuring it remains visually appealing in all contexts.
